Join the Hong Kong IOSH Community for an insightful and practical event on Suspended Working Platform (SWP) Safety: Managing Hazards and Ensuring Compliance.
This technical event offers a comprehensive overview of safety practices for both permanent and temporary suspended working platform systems. We will explore the full lifecycle of SWPs — from design and daily operation to inspection, maintenance and eventual dismantling.
Our guest speaker, Ir Tse Wing Ning, Richard, Director of Allied Rich Asia Limited, (Past Chairman IOSH Hong Kong) will share his professional insights and extensive experience in the field, offering valuable guidance on best practices and risk management for suspended working platforms.
Whether you are a safety professional, engineer, contractor or facility manager, this event will equip you with the tools and insights needed to maintain the highest safety standards and ensure regulatory compliance in your operations.
